Oregon Statutes - Chapter 411 - Adult and Family Services; Public Assistance - Section 411.890 - JOBS Plus Implementation Council; duties; membership.

A JOBS Plus Implementation Council shall be established in service areas to be determined by the Director of Human Services to assist the JOBS Plus Advisory Board, the Department of Human Services and the Employment Department in the administration of the JOBS Plus Program and to allow local flexibility in dealing with the particular needs of each county. Each council shall be primarily responsible for recruiting and encouraging participation of employment providers in the county. Each council shall be composed of seven members who shall be appointed by the county commissioners in each county in the district. Council members shall be residents of the district in which they are appointed and shall serve four-year terms. Six members of the council shall be from the local business community. At least one member shall be a current or former recipient of the temporary assistance for needy families program, the food stamp program or the unemployment insurance program. [1995 c.561 §11 and 1995 c.816 §24; 1997 c.581 §20; 2001 c.900 §96]
